However, there’s a sprinkle of improvements that ensure Rise of the Tomb Raider feels anything but formulaic.Īs with the reboot, Lara’s latest adventure relishes in exploration. Unsurprisingly, Crystal Dynamics has adhered to the well-oiled paradigm that made the 2013 game so successful, and it works like a charm here once again. Naturally, she’s not alone in the search, and has to contend with a mysterious organisation known as Trinity, who give her a reason to whip out her bow and pistol again for another murderous treasure hunt. Set a few years after the events of 2013’s origins adventure, Rise of the Tomb Raider sees Croft following in her late father’s footsteps for the mythical city of Kitezh, which is nestled in the freezing mountainous regions of Siberia. Lara comes home to PlayStation, and boy have we missed her Indeed, Miss Croft’s 2013 overhaul proved that this aging series has the action chops to duke it out with the biggest franchises on the market, and with Rise of the Tomb Raider, Crystal Dynamics further cements the dominance of this iconic heroine in the action-adventure space.įollowing a year-long fling with Xbox, Rise of the Tomb Raider: 20 Year Celebration hits PlayStation 4 with more than just the stonking campaign of the original there’s a heap of new content thrown into the mix here, including the PlayStation VR-compatible Blood Ties, co-op Endurance mode, and the undead-infested Lara’s Nightmare. Rebooted twice already, Lara Croft’s exotic excursions, which has seen the dexterous trinket-pincher scaling precarious rock faces and putting local wildlife on the endangered species list since the PSOne days, has had its fair share of ups and downs, yet has deftly managed to reinvent itself in a post-Uncharted world.
